Seasonal Travel, Weather, and Packing Tips for Rakula

The Northern Territory experiences a warm climate with distinct wet and dry seasons. The dry season typically brings cooler evenings and pleasant daytime temperatures, creating ideal conditions for outdoor exploration and family activities. The wet season can bring refreshing rain showers and lush landscapes, but it can also lead to humid conditions and occasional heavy rain. Packing smart means layering for variable conditions, bringing sun protection for day trips, and having quick-dry clothing for potential showers. A compact umbrella, a lightweight rain jacket, and breathable fabrics can make a big difference in comfort.
